Adams takes office at a time when folks are returning to New York from their suburban exile. When Broadway is back with standing-ovation energy. When offices are gradually reopening. And, I’m happy to report, when New York’s real estate climate is palpably hot.
A seller’s market is definitely emerging.
Sales during the past six months have been robust. Contract signings are up. The amount of days that listings are on the market is down. 67 contracts were signed at $4 million and above the week before Thanksgiving, a record-setting number for that period. I expect 2022 will be a seller’s market with plenty of momentum for a long ride.
